Thanks to Jag79 my 03 STR runs the exact same Magnaflow 4" s/s rolled edge exhaust tip. IMO the best tip. Again IMO, don't let them stick out too far. I was runnin Mina's twin pipe exhaust tips (they whistle "Like a whistle" under heavy acceleration). The magnaflow 4" do the right trick. I had them set so they barely protrude from the rear bumper valence (like stock). They properly fill (not over-do) the exhaust tip cut out, and look both mean and tastefully appointed.
